Common Side Effects

Tegretol can cause a range of side effects, including skin rash, itching, and hives. These side effects are usually mild and temporary, but in some cases, they can be severe. If you experience any of these side effects, it’s essential to talk to your doctor about the best course of action.

Severe Side Effects

In rare cases, Tegretol can cause more severe side effects, including Stevens-Johnson syndrome and toxic epidermal necrolysis. These life-threatening conditions can cause widespread skin blistering and peeling, as well as internal organ damage. If you experience any of these side effects, seek medical attention immediately.
